Rutherford B. Hayes — American President born on October 04, 1822, died on January 17, 1893

Rutherford Birchard Hayes was the 19th President of the United States. As president, he oversaw the end of Reconstruction, began the efforts that led to civil service reform, and attempted to reconcile the divisions left over from the Civil War and Reconstruction... (wikipedia)
